minishell/parser/static/small_parse_table/small_parse_table_1630.c
2024-04-28 19:59:01 +02:00

140 lines
4.4 KiB
C

/* ************************************************************************** */
/* */
/* ::: :::::::: */
/* small_parse_table_1630.c :+: :+: :+: */
/* +:+ +:+ +:+ */
/* By: maiboyer <maiboyer@student.42.fr> +#+ +:+ +#+ */
/* +#+#+#+#+#+ +#+ */
/* Created: 2024/04/14 19:17:54 by maiboyer #+# #+# */
/* Updated: 2024/04/14 19:18:20 by maiboyer ### ########.fr */
/* */
/* ************************************************************************** */
#include "./small_parse_table.h"
void small_parse_table_8150(t_small_parse_table_array *v)
{
v->a[163000] = anon_sym_STAR_EQ;
v->a[163001] = anon_sym_SLASH_EQ;
v->a[163002] = anon_sym_PERCENT_EQ;
v->a[163003] = anon_sym_STAR_STAR_EQ;
v->a[163004] = anon_sym_LT_LT_EQ;
v->a[163005] = anon_sym_GT_GT_EQ;
v->a[163006] = anon_sym_AMP_EQ;
v->a[163007] = anon_sym_CARET_EQ;
v->a[163008] = anon_sym_PIPE_EQ;
v->a[163009] = anon_sym_EQ_TILDE;
v->a[163010] = 8;
v->a[163011] = actions(71);
v->a[163012] = 1;
v->a[163013] = sym_comment;
v->a[163014] = actions(7220);
v->a[163015] = 1;
v->a[163016] = anon_sym_STAR_STAR;
v->a[163017] = actions(6793);
v->a[163018] = 2;
v->a[163019] = anon_sym_PLUS_PLUS;
small_parse_table_8151(v);
}
void small_parse_table_8151(t_small_parse_table_array *v)
{
v->a[163020] = anon_sym_DASH_DASH;
v->a[163021] = actions(7214);
v->a[163022] = 2;
v->a[163023] = anon_sym_LT_LT;
v->a[163024] = anon_sym_GT_GT;
v->a[163025] = actions(7216);
v->a[163026] = 2;
v->a[163027] = anon_sym_PLUS;
v->a[163028] = anon_sym_DASH;
v->a[163029] = actions(7218);
v->a[163030] = 3;
v->a[163031] = anon_sym_STAR;
v->a[163032] = anon_sym_SLASH;
v->a[163033] = anon_sym_PERCENT;
v->a[163034] = actions(6807);
v->a[163035] = 6;
v->a[163036] = anon_sym_EQ;
v->a[163037] = anon_sym_PIPE;
v->a[163038] = anon_sym_CARET;
v->a[163039] = anon_sym_AMP;
small_parse_table_8152(v);
}
void small_parse_table_8152(t_small_parse_table_array *v)
{
v->a[163040] = anon_sym_LT;
v->a[163041] = anon_sym_GT;
v->a[163042] = actions(6805);
v->a[163043] = 21;
v->a[163044] = sym_test_operator;
v->a[163045] = anon_sym_RPAREN_RPAREN;
v->a[163046] = anon_sym_PLUS_EQ;
v->a[163047] = anon_sym_DASH_EQ;
v->a[163048] = anon_sym_STAR_EQ;
v->a[163049] = anon_sym_SLASH_EQ;
v->a[163050] = anon_sym_PERCENT_EQ;
v->a[163051] = anon_sym_STAR_STAR_EQ;
v->a[163052] = anon_sym_LT_LT_EQ;
v->a[163053] = anon_sym_GT_GT_EQ;
v->a[163054] = anon_sym_AMP_EQ;
v->a[163055] = anon_sym_CARET_EQ;
v->a[163056] = anon_sym_PIPE_EQ;
v->a[163057] = anon_sym_PIPE_PIPE;
v->a[163058] = anon_sym_AMP_AMP;
v->a[163059] = anon_sym_EQ_EQ;
small_parse_table_8153(v);
}
void small_parse_table_8153(t_small_parse_table_array *v)
{
v->a[163060] = anon_sym_BANG_EQ;
v->a[163061] = anon_sym_LT_EQ;
v->a[163062] = anon_sym_GT_EQ;
v->a[163063] = anon_sym_EQ_TILDE;
v->a[163064] = anon_sym_QMARK;
v->a[163065] = 4;
v->a[163066] = actions(71);
v->a[163067] = 1;
v->a[163068] = sym_comment;
v->a[163069] = actions(7457);
v->a[163070] = 1;
v->a[163071] = sym__concat;
v->a[163072] = actions(6820);
v->a[163073] = 14;
v->a[163074] = anon_sym_EQ;
v->a[163075] = anon_sym_PIPE;
v->a[163076] = anon_sym_CARET;
v->a[163077] = anon_sym_AMP;
v->a[163078] = anon_sym_LT;
v->a[163079] = anon_sym_GT;
small_parse_table_8154(v);
}
void small_parse_table_8154(t_small_parse_table_array *v)
{
v->a[163080] = anon_sym_LT_LT;
v->a[163081] = anon_sym_GT_GT;
v->a[163082] = anon_sym_PLUS;
v->a[163083] = anon_sym_DASH;
v->a[163084] = anon_sym_STAR;
v->a[163085] = anon_sym_SLASH;
v->a[163086] = anon_sym_PERCENT;
v->a[163087] = anon_sym_STAR_STAR;
v->a[163088] = actions(6818);
v->a[163089] = 22;
v->a[163090] = anon_sym_PLUS_PLUS;
v->a[163091] = anon_sym_DASH_DASH;
v->a[163092] = anon_sym_PLUS_EQ;
v->a[163093] = anon_sym_DASH_EQ;
v->a[163094] = anon_sym_STAR_EQ;
v->a[163095] = anon_sym_SLASH_EQ;
v->a[163096] = anon_sym_PERCENT_EQ;
v->a[163097] = anon_sym_STAR_STAR_EQ;
v->a[163098] = anon_sym_LT_LT_EQ;
v->a[163099] = anon_sym_GT_GT_EQ;
small_parse_table_8155(v);
}
/* EOF small_parse_table_1630.c */